Output 87e392e65f6261108cfef2c64b369441ebd6000af99da102a52417e40e302b99:3

value
351844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a5e6b85ad873c0163fbc88f9ca6b04d713ad2bc OP_EQUAL
address
3FmF6W7p748UXtihNZLJQhxgcxDtWWUAhE
transaction
87e392e65f6261108cfef2c64b369441ebd6000af99da102a52417e40e302b99
spent
true